另一方面,Java数据类型有基本数据类型,参照数据类型
(2) 8种基本数据类型:
1 .整数型:字节、短整型、长整型
2 .浮点数据类型:浮点,双精度
3 .字符类型: char
4 .布尔型:布尔型
a .整数类型的默认类型为int
必须定义长类型数据,后跟l或l
c .浮点数类型,默认数据为双精度
定义浮点类型的数据。 数据必须加上f和f
对于e.double,可以在数据后加上d或d。 一般省略
f.char表示字符类型,分配值时将数据放入“值”
g.String表示字符串类型,赋值时数据必须放入“值”
3 :使用变量的步骤
步骤1 :声明变量,并根据数据类型向内存请求空间
数据类型变量名称; int money
步骤2 :“将数据存储在对应的存储器区域中”
变量名=数值; money=1000;
步骤1和步骤3的集成
数据类型变量名称=数值; int money=1000;
步骤3 :使用变量检索和使用数据
四:变量名规格
1 .变量名首字母必须为字母、下划线、美元符号,其余部分必须为任意数量的数字、字母、下划线、美元符号
2 .简短,可以清楚地显示变量的作用,通常是第一个单词首字母的大写字母
3 .变量要声明并赋值后再使用
4 .声明不能重复两个同名变量
五。 变量的范围
从定义变量开始,到当前“}”结束,变量退出范围后被回收
(6)基本数据类型转换
1 .自动类型转换(隐式类型转换) )可以自动从小到大
2 .强制类型转换:需要从大到小的强制转换器,导致精度损失和溢出
byte---short---int---long---float---double
可以自动从左向右从小到大转换类型
必须强制从左侧较大的类型到较小的类型进行类型转换